Sample Advanced Section Exam 1) An airplane is flying in level flight and steady speed. It weighs 250,000 lbf. It is powered by two jet engines, one under each wing. Each engine delivers 10,000 lbf. of thrust. a) draw a free-body diagram showing the forces acting on the airplane b) what is the Lift force acting on the airplane? c) what is the Drag force acting on the airplane? 2) A diver stands on a diving board ready to jump into the swimming pool. He weighs 40 kg. a) Draw a diagram of the forces and moments (torques) acting on the diving board b) What is the magnitude and direction of the moment (or torque) acting at point A. On the other end, at the tip of the see-saw, is a pile of cheese weighing 4 Kg. What position must Mickey stand at in order to avoid tipping the see-saw? (you can ignore the weight of the see-saw) A 5) A Rollercoaster car is running down the track. At the position shown it has reached a speed of 20 meters/second. a) how fast will it be going when it reaches the bottom of the loop (point A) which lies 20 meters below the current position of the car. b) How how can it go on the track before the speed goes to zero and the car starts to fall back? Θ 6) A brick weighing 5 lbf lies on a table. The coefficient of static friction between the brick and the table is 0.3. What is the angle, Θ, to which the table must be raised to get the brick to start sliding?
